Local News

The nation paid tribute to World War Two veteran Captain Sir Tom Moore when he was cremated with a military guard of honour and Royal Air Force fly-past. He had helped raise millions of pounds for the health service during the coronavirus pandemic.

Anas Sarwar has been named Scottish Labour’s new leader. This comes ahead of a poll for the country’s devolved parliament in May.

World News

The White House has indicated that it plans to ignore Donald Trump’s speech on Sunday to a conservative conference in Florida, where he is slated to go on the offensive against his successor.

Italian archaeologists have unearthed an ancient ceremonial carriage from a villa just outside the ruins of Pompei, which was buried in a volcanic eruption in 79 AD.

One woman was shot and wounded and dozens of people were detained in Myanmar in what is seen as the most extensive police crackdown on protesters who are agitating against the junta.
